I like the original layout on it. Winding curves and little bumps are layed out in ways that will challenge even the best racers out there. If you're one of those that like to kick AI truck's lol you'll have to find something else to play on. They just cant go around on this track. Be carefull around cp 1 as if you shave it to sharp it wont register.

I like this one a lot. I in fact had such a great time on it i selected it for our next apl selection coming out in august.
Thx Whynni for this nice track. I'm sure many will enjoy.
